- The distance between Savannah, Georgia, Usa and Vestervig, Denmark is approximately 7,042 km or 4,376 mi.
- To reach Savannah, Georgia in this distance one would set out from Vestervig bearing 288.6°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Savannah, Georgia bearing 217.8° or SW .
- Savannah, Georgia has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Vestervig has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Savannah, Georgia is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Vestervig is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The mean temperature is 11.3 °C (20.3°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.3 °C (4.1°F) more in Savannah, Georgia.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 439.3 mm (17.3 in) more which is equivalent to 439.3 l/m² (10.78 US gal/ft²) or 4,393,000 l/ha (469,641 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/2 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 24.6° higher in Savannah, Georgia than in Vestervig.
